History of IOSH

The Institution of Occupational Safety and Health (IOSH) was founded in 1945 as the Institution of Industrial Safety Officers (IISO), a division of the Royal Society for the Prevention of Accidents (RoSPA). The organization gained its charitable status in 1962 and continues to operate as a not-for-profit organization.

Since its inception, IOSH has been dedicated to promoting occupational safety and health standards in the United Kingdom and beyond. It has grown to become the world's Chartered body for safety and health professionals.

Today, IOSH has over 47,000 members in more than 130 countries. Its members work in a variety of industries, including construction, manufacturing, healthcare, and education, among others. IOSH provides its members with training and support to help them promote safety and health in the workplace.

In addition to its work with individual members, IOSH also collaborates with businesses and governments to promote safety and health standards. Chartered Membership of IOSH is recognized worldwide as the hallmark of professional excellence in workplace safety and health.

IOSH Training Courses

IOSH offers a range of training courses that are designed to help individuals and organizations improve their health and safety practices. These courses are aimed at professionals working in a variety of industries, including construction, manufacturing, and healthcare.

IOSH training courses provide a combination of up-to-date theory and practical knowledge to enable individuals to earn qualifications. These qualifications allow holders to ensure that health and safety practices in their workplace are current, effective, and well-managed.

One of the most popular IOSH courses is the Managing Safely course. This course is designed for managers and supervisors and provides them with the knowledge and skills they need to manage health and safety in their workplace. The course covers a range of topics, including risk assessment, accident investigation, and legal responsibilities.

IOSH also offers a range of other courses, including the Working Safely course, which is aimed at employees at all levels, and the Fire Safety for Managers course, which provides managers with the knowledge and skills they need to manage fire safety in their workplace.

How to Become an IOSH Member

Becoming a member of the Institution of Occupational Safety and Health (IOSH) is a great way to enhance your career in health and safety. IOSH offers a range of membership categories to suit different levels of knowledge, qualifications, and experience.

To become a member of IOSH, you will need to meet certain criteria.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Determine the membership category that best suits your qualifications and experience. IOSH offers several categories of membership, including Affiliate, Associate, Technical, Graduate, Chartered, and Fellow.

  2. Check the eligibility criteria for the membership category you are interested in. For example, to become an Associate or Technical member, you will need to have completed a qualification in Occupational Safety and Health (OSH) at Level 3 or above.

  3. Apply for membership online or by post. You will need to provide evidence of your qualifications and experience, and pay the relevant membership fee.

  4. Once your application has been processed, you will receive confirmation of your membership category. You can then start enjoying the benefits of being an IOSH member, including access to training and events, networking opportunities, and professional development resources.

It is worth noting that IOSH also offers student membership for those who are actively studying health and safety. Student members can benefit from discounted membership fees and access to a range of resources to support their studies.
